Chelsea have opened contact with Real Madrid to explore a transfer for Brazilian forward Rodrygo, indicating willingness to complete a deal either in January or next summer. Rodrygo was heavily linked with several Premier League clubs over the summer, including Arsenal and Liverpool, but remained at Madrid. Arsenal targeted him as a left-side replacement for Gabriel Martinelli, while Liverpool viewed him as an option for the departed Luis Diaz. Reports suggest Chelsea could secure the player for significantly less than Madrid sought in the summer. Tottenham also retain interest, leaving Chelsea to face competition should negotiations progress.
